kortik wrote:
1) experimentation on adv projectile barrels/feeders needs to be fixed.
2) weapons that require electronic parts (e.g., control mechanism) get no benefit from those parts (and all such partsgive same benefit- or lack therefof -nomatter the quality of the materials used. either some benefit needs to be calculated into these weapons or the base stats (before component and resource attribute calculation is added) need to be boosted to make them viable weapons.
3) 75% of the weapons with gated resources use resources with crucial stats so low that they are almost invariably poorer weapons (or only marginally better) than lower certified weapons (e.g., laser carbine is superior to any elite i can make with best resources that have everspawned on the server and DXR6 is only about the same as laser carbine after allowing for the acid damage and lower armor piercing). Either adjust the crucial stat rangehigher on gated resources, raise base damage (before resource attribute calculation is added to determining final outcome) on the schematics that require gated resources, or raise possible attribute range for all attributes on all resources to range from 1-1000 (so that eventually when a decent version of that type spawns, it will be possible to build a decent weapon with that type resource).
4) make effectiveness rating on crafting stations and crafting tools mean something in terms of success/failure rate. I'm using a +40 ER crafting station and a +13 ER crafting tool and still getting the same number of failures as when I used a -9 tool and -2 station.
5) fix random number table on crafting/experimentation success/failure outcome. My experience over 3 months has been that if I get 1 critical failure, the odds of a second critical failure in a row are about 35%
sorry, can't find edit function.
want to add a suggestion for how the devs can deal with the multiple PH situation. stacking the bnuses is obviously out of the question, as pointed out by at least one of the above posts.
But, how about using a modifier based on number of PH's in schematic? 1xsingle PH bonus for 1 PH, 1.1xbonus for 2 PH's, 1.2 for 3 PHs, etc up to 1.9xbonus for T21's. This will produce a benefit for weapons that require multiple PH's (and maybe even offset the negative effect of crappy gated resources these weapons tend to require), without making a T21 more powerful than a rocket launcher.

1, Fix experimentation on broken schematics.
2, Change the schematics so that the weapon stats are logically based on resource stats. Every gun seems to be based on Conductivity and Overall Quality; this makes sense for a laser rifle, but shouldn't an SG82 be based on Cold Resistance and OQ, and Launcher pistol be based on Shock Resistance or Unit Toughness,and a Spraystick or DX2 be based Decay Resistance (being acid based they would need to resist corrosion). This would make gathering resources more challenging and interesting (and harder).
3, Fix Republic Blaster Cert (so that Someone has it).
4, Increase variation among and balance betweenexisting weapons or add new schematics (so that we're not always making the same type). Prime example; Have the SR Combat Pistol do the most damage but at the expense of range (max 48m), have the Republic Blaster do slightly less damage but fire out to 64m, and have the DX2 do slightly less damage than the other two, but of an unusual type (acid). Thus a Pistoleer has to chose between three roughly equal weapons, each with it's merits and flaws (and we Weapons smiths won't be always making the same guns). Similarly, have the T21 do high damage but low speed, (as it is now) have the laser rifle do average damage and have average speed, and have the spraystick do the least damage, but with better speed and lower range penalties. To some degree SWG already does this, but I would like to see it taken further.

#1. Carbineers and Riflemen are at an enormous disadvantage due to Krayt Tissues not properly stacking. The vast majority of popular carbines and rifles require multiple identical krayt tissues, for the bonus of only one. Any rifle/carbine that only requires one is either mostly obsolete due to being so low in the skill tree, or rendered useless due to poor balancing. Carbines and Rifles should receive their own enhancement, one that would go directly into a rifle barrel or onto particular rifles/carbines to alleviate this issue.
